Israel Frees Palestinian Captives, Completing Third Round of Prisoner Swaps

HeadlineJan 31, 2025

More than 100 Palestinians, including over two dozen children, were freed by Israel Thursday as part of the Gaza ceasefire and hostage exchange deal. Massive crowds gathered in Ramallah, in the occupied West Bank, to celebrate and welcome prisoners returning home.

Freed prisoner: “We are part of these people who tell the world we do not leave our prisoners inside the prison. Our message is national unity. This people deserves national unity.”

One of those released was the prominent Palestinian resistance leader Zakaria Zubeidi, who in 2021 notably broke out of an Israeli maximum-security prison through a tunnel with five others. They were recaptured days later. In 2006, Zubeidi co-founded the world-famous Freedom Theatre in the Jenin refugee camp, where Zubeidi was born.

Meanwhile, the U.N. is calling for 2,500 Palestinian children to be immediately evacuated from Gaza to receive urgent medical treatment, as they could die in the coming weeks.
